运维实施工程师如何进行系统部署?
在信息化时代,运维实施工程师扮演着至关重要的角色。他们负责确保企业信息系统的稳定运行,而系统部署则是他们日常工作中的一项重要任务。那么,运维实施工程师如何进行系统部署呢?本文将从以下几个方面进行详细阐述。
一、了解系统需求
在进行系统部署之前,运维实施工程师首先要明确系统需求。这包括:
业务需求:了解企业业务流程,确定系统需要实现的功能。
性能需求:根据业务需求,评估系统所需的硬件配置和性能指标。
安全性需求:分析系统可能面临的安全威胁,制定相应的安全策略。
兼容性需求:确保系统与其他现有系统或组件的兼容性。
二、制定部署计划
在明确系统需求后,运维实施工程师需要制定详细的部署计划。以下是一些关键步骤:
确定部署方案:根据系统需求,选择合适的部署方案,如本地部署、云部署等。
准备部署环境:包括硬件设备、网络环境、操作系统、数据库等。
编写部署脚本:利用自动化工具或编写脚本,简化部署过程。
测试部署过程:在模拟环境中进行部署测试,确保部署过程稳定可靠。
三、实施部署
在完成部署计划后,运维实施工程师开始实施部署。以下是一些关键步骤:
安装操作系统:按照部署计划,安装操作系统。
配置网络环境:配置IP地址、子网掩码、网关等网络参数。
安装数据库:根据系统需求,安装相应的数据库软件。
部署应用程序:按照部署脚本,部署应用程序。
配置系统参数:调整系统参数,以满足性能和安全需求。
四、系统测试与优化
在系统部署完成后,运维实施工程师需要进行系统测试与优化,确保系统稳定运行。以下是一些关键步骤:
功能测试:验证系统功能是否符合业务需求。
性能测试:评估系统性能,如响应时间、并发用户数等。
安全性测试:检查系统是否存在安全漏洞。
优化系统配置:根据测试结果,调整系统配置,提高系统性能。
五、案例分享
以下是一个实际案例:
某企业计划部署一套ERP系统,以提高企业管理效率。运维实施工程师首先了解企业业务流程,确定系统需求。随后,制定详细的部署计划,包括硬件设备、网络环境、操作系统、数据库等。在实施部署过程中,运维实施工程师按照部署脚本,顺利完成操作系统、数据库和应用程序的安装。在系统测试与优化阶段,运维实施工程师发现系统响应时间较长,经过分析,发现是数据库配置不合理导致的。通过调整数据库配置,系统性能得到显著提升。
总结
运维实施工程师在进行系统部署时,需要充分了解系统需求,制定详细的部署计划,实施部署,并进行系统测试与优化。通过不断积累经验,提高自身技能,才能更好地为企业提供优质的服务。
猜你喜欢:猎头合作网